102 struct devprobe2 {
103 	struct net_device *(*probe)(int unit);
104 	int status;	/* non-zero if autoprobe has failed */
105 };
106 
107 static int __init probe_list2(int unit, struct devprobe2 *p, int autoprobe)
108 {
109 	struct net_device *dev;
110 	for (; p->probe; p++) {
111 		if (autoprobe && p->status)
112 			continue;
113 		dev = p->probe(unit);
114 		if (!IS_ERR(dev))
115 			return 0;
116 		if (autoprobe)
117 			p->status = PTR_ERR(dev);
118 	}
119 	return -ENODEV;
120 }

289 /*
290  * Unified ethernet device probe, segmented per architecture and
291  * per bus interface. This drives the legacy devices only for now.
292  */
293 
294 static void __init ethif_probe2(int unit)
295 {
296 	unsigned long base_addr = netdev_boot_base("eth", unit);
297 
298 	if (base_addr == 1)
299 		return;
300 
301 	(void)(	probe_list2(unit, m68k_probes, base_addr == 0) &&
302 		probe_list2(unit, eisa_probes, base_addr == 0) &&
303 		probe_list2(unit, mca_probes, base_addr == 0) &&
304 		probe_list2(unit, isa_probes, base_addr == 0) &&
305 		probe_list2(unit, parport_probes, base_addr == 0));
306 }
